Vectors are organisms that transmit diseases. The five main vectors in Singapore are mosquitoes, cockroaches, flies, rats and rat fleas. The diseases they spread include dengue, typhus, leptospirosis, cholera and typhoid.
NEA monitors vector populations through surveillance and enforcement. For rats, the key to controlling their numbers is proper refuse management.
